איוב, פרק ל״ב, פסוק י״ט

Job 32:19Sefaria

הִנֵּֽה־בִטְנִ֗י כְּיַ֥יִן לֹֽא־יִפָּתֵ֑חַ כְּאֹב֥וֹת חֲ֝דָשִׁ֗ים יִבָּקֵֽעַ׃

The immense internal pressure of unexpressed thoughts is captured through a vivid image of intense fermentation. Elihu is filled with a spirit and a rush of words he desperately wants to speak, feeling an internal brewing akin to wine sealed tightly in a closed vessel. The longer the wine remains unopened, preserving its potent flavor, the more the fermenting gases build up, creating a massive pressure that demands to break free. This perfectly reflects Elihu's state; he has been brimming with arguments since the very beginning of the debate but has forced himself to remain completely silent [אלשיך].

The primary approach among commentators explains that this pressure threatens to burst forth like wine stored in large leather wineskins, which [רש״י] describes as being as tall as a person. Although a minority opinion suggests the imagery refers to a type of pipe or tube, the widely accepted understanding is that it describes wineskins [אבן עזרא].

The metaphor specifically highlights the use of new wineskins. When active, fermenting wine is poured into fresh wineskins, the rising internal pressure causes them to split and break quite easily. This creates a direct parallel to Elihu's personal situation. Just as a new wineskin is not yet conditioned to hold fermenting wine and bursts quickly, Elihu, being a young man, is not accustomed to suppressing his words. The natural passion and boiling blood of his youth make it impossible for him to remain patient. The arguments stored inside him have grown so powerful that they are on the verge of erupting outward on their own [מצודת דוד, מלבי״ם, אלשיך].
